Which of the following statements is false?

A. Financing activities in a cash flow statement include obtaining resources from owners and creditors and repaying amounts borrowed.
B. The operating activities in a cash flow statement include transactions which affect the sale and the purchase or production of goods and services.
C. Investing activities in a cash flow statement include acquiring and selling long-term assets.
D. The statement of cash flows is similar to the income statement, as they both determine the net income for a company.
E. The statement of cash flows reports the cash receipts and cash payments of an entity over a period of time.


Ans: D. The statement of cash flows is similar to the income statement, as they both determine the net income for a company.
